Infrastructure


Schools

Sayyidina Abu Bakar Secondary School is the sole government secondary school for the estate. The local government primary schools include: * Dato Basir Primary School * Dato Marsal Primary School — opened in January 1990, initially known as ("Kampong Manggis Primary School"). It was renamed to the current name by the consent of
Sultan Hassanal Bolkiah Hassanal Bolkiah ibni Omar Ali Saifuddien III ( Jawi: ; born 15 July 1946) is the 29th and current Sultan and Yang di-Pertuan of Brunei since 1967 and the Prime Minister of Brunei since independence from the United Kingdom in 1984. He is one ...
on 23 January 1992 in honour of a local figure who had made significant contribution to the country's education system at that time. * Lambak Kanan Jalan 49 Primary School * Perpindahan Lambak Kanan Jalan 10 Primary School Dato Basir Primary School and Lambak Kanan Jalan 49 Primary School also house a ("religious school" i.e. school for the country's Islamic religious primary education). Two other in the area, namely Lambak Kanan Religious School and Perpindahan Lambak Kanan Jalan 77 Religious School, have dedicated grounds.

Mosque

Perpindahan Lambak Kanan Mosque is the local mosque; it was inaugurated in 1997 by
Sultan Hassanal Bolkiah Hassanal Bolkiah ibni Omar Ali Saifuddien III ( Jawi: ; born 15 July 1946) is the 29th and current Sultan and Yang di-Pertuan of Brunei since 1967 and the Prime Minister of Brunei since independence from the United Kingdom in 1984. He is one ...
. It can accommodate 2,400 worshippers.
